Book Description

September 1994
Dave Thomas, the enormously popular Wendy's Old-Fashioned Hamburgers founder and TV commercial celebrity, shows how to empower one's life by applying the same simple, Bible-based principles that turned Wendy's into a successful world-wide business.

Editorial Reviews

From Publishers Weekly

Dave Thomas, founder of the Wendy's restaurant chain, here serves up his philosophy instead of hamburgers. Basing his approach to life on a philosophy of positive thinking, honesty, hard work and contributing to the community, Thomas spins out his ideas in a friendly, good-guy format. Readers could almost close their eyes and imagine this was Norman Vincent Peale flipping hamburgers. While some may delight in The World According to Thomas, others may prefer to sink their teeth into something with more beef.
Copyright 1994 Reed Business Information, Inc.

From Booklist

Riding the popularity of Dave's Way: A New Approach to Old-fashioned Success (1991), Wendy International's founder and senior chairman strikes again with this cornucopia of upbeat anecdotal and motivational reflections. Stating that this is about how success can be achieved for ordinary people through doing the right things, Thomas ruminates on a variety of topics organized under chapters entitled Faith, Discipline, Caring, Teamwork, Support, Leadership, etc. When Thomas talks about Wendy operations (for example, instead of hiring a costly market research firm to test-market a proposed taco salad, the company merely purchased chili ladles and taco chips and began selling the salads, which became a popular menu item) or discusses other aspects of his busy life (a recent operation for a benign tumor), the prose moves swiftly. But reflections and thoughts about various individuals (such as a network producer who adopted a teenager) are too short and uninvolving to make much of a mark. This is a somewhat bland mishmash of thoughts and stories penned by a successful businessperson who seems much more personable in his television advertisements. Nevertheless, because of Thomas' successful track record, this will attract readers interested in learning more about what Thomas perceives as the skills, attitudes, and values shared by successful people. Sue-Ellen Beauregard

Dave Thomas autobiography (if you want to call it that) is a collection of lessons learned on what leads to success in everyday life. There is little in here about the building of Wendy's and some things about his personal life but it mostly recounts the stories of those he knows and what makes them successful. For those looking for a lighter read about common sense, good values, and treating people like you would want to be treated this is a great place to go but not for a lot of business information.

The publisher's review of this book suggests that the material is "light," which may be accurate. However, Dave Thomas has a gentle way about his writing style that I believe is areflection of his personality. The book is full of interesting stories about his success in building a hamburger empire, and includes some valuable lessons about building a business with integrity and compassion. Wendy's has been famous for supporting the communities it serves, and I enjoyed reading about Dave's philosophy of hard work, honesty, and charity. These are things we can all benefit from. I recommend this book to any aspiring entrepreneur.
